Fireplace Built Ins Installation in Raleigh, NC
Fireplace built-ins installation involves creating custom cabinetry, shelving, or surround features that integrate seamlessly with an existing fireplace. This service can enhance both the aesthetic appeal and functionality of a living space, offering homeowners a dedicated area for decorative items, media equipment, or fire tools. Projects often include installing mantel surrounds, built-in shelves, or custom cabinetry that complements the room’s design and improves storage options around the fireplace.
Homeowners typically seek this service when updating or renovating their living areas, aiming to create a cohesive look or add practical storage solutions. Before requesting fireplace built-ins installation, property owners should consider the fireplace’s style, the desired materials, and the overall design theme of the room. Understanding the scope of the project, including any necessary adjustments to existing structures or finishes, can help ensure the final result aligns with their vision.

Fireplace Built Ins Installation Questions
What are fireplace built-ins? Fireplace built-ins are custom-designed cabinetry or shelving installed around a fireplace to enhance its appearance and functionality.
What styles are available for fireplace built-ins? They can be crafted in various styles, including traditional, modern, and rustic, to match different interior designs.
What materials are used for fireplace built-ins? Common materials include wood, MDF, and laminate, selected to complement the existing decor and withstand heat exposure.
Are fireplace built-ins suitable for all fireplace types? They are typically designed for both wood-burning and gas fireplaces, with adjustments made for safety and ventilation requirements.
